To start, gather your supplies: small glass roller bottles, essential oils, a carrier oil (such as fractionated coconut oil or jojoba), and a small funnel or pipette. First, decide on the purpose of your blend. Think about what aromatherapy benefits you want to achieve. Once you’ve chosen your oils, determine the right dilution ratio, which typically ranges from 1-5% depending on the oil and intended use. For most personal blends, a 2-3% dilution is sufficient. Use the pipette or funnel to add your essential oils to the roller bottle. Be precise but cautious—essential oils are potent, and a little goes a long way.

Next, fill the rest of the bottle with your carrier oil. Secure the roller ball top firmly and give the bottle a gentle shake to blend everything well. How Do I Prevent Contamination During Roller Bottle Blending?

You can prevent contamination by thoroughly sterilizing your tools and roller bottles using techniques like boiling or alcohol wipes. Always wash your hands before blending and avoid touching the inside of bottles or caps. Store your oils in a cool, dark place to prevent degradation and contamination. Following proper sterilization techniques and storage precautions guarantees your blends stay pure and safe, minimizing the risk of bacteria or mold growth.

Are There Safety Concerns With Certain Essential Oil Combinations?

Yes, there are safety concerns with certain essential oil combinations. You should always prioritize dilution safety to prevent skin irritation or sensitization. Some blends may also increase allergen risk, especially if you’re sensitive or prone to allergies. Always research each oil’s compatibility, perform patch tests, and avoid mixing oils that could cause adverse reactions. Proper dilution and knowledge help keep your roller blends safe and enjoyable.
